Spain has found the third package bomb at Torrejon Air Base

On Thursday, Spanish authorities found a third booby-trapped package at Torrejon Air Base in the capital, Madrid, hours after the Spanish arms company ‘Anstalza’ received a booby-trapped package, which was preceded from another package that exploded in front of the Ukrainian embassy in Madrid. And local newspaper El Pais reported that a package similar to the two packages sent to the Ukrainian embassy and the Anstalza arms manufacturing company was found at the Torrejon de Ardoz air base in Madrid.

And he explained that “at three in the morning, the military unit of the air base notified the security forces that they had received a suspicious envelope, and the necessary measures were immediately taken, while the national police examined the package”.

In the past 24 hours Spanish police have announced that a booby-trapped package exploded at the Ukrainian embassy in the capital, Madrid, injuring a member of the diplomatic mission.

Spanish authorities have addressed the explosion of the Ukrainian embassy in Madrid as a “terrorist act”, while Ukrainian authorities have ordered increased security measures for all its embassies abroad following the incident.
